RDY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review
157 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Dr. Reddy's Laboratories (RDY)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$1.39B — up 12% from $1.24B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 17 funds closed out of RDY and 16 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 61 trimmed existing stakes and 46 added.
The largest buyer was Fisher Asset Management, adding an estimated $20.7M. The largest seller was BlackRock Group, cutting an estimated $20.8M.
